A gastronomic treasure: rare Elzevier edition of De la Varennes revolutionary work
on French cuisine, and French patisserie in particular



[VARENNE, François-Pierre de la (attributed)].
Le pastissier[!] François. Où est enseigné la maniere de faire toute sorte de patisserie, tres-utile à toute sorte de personnes. Ensemble le moyen dáprester toutes sortes d'oeufs pour les jours maigres, & autres, en plus de soixante façons.
Amsterdam, Lodewijk & Daniel Elzevier, 1655. 12mo. With an engraved title page, Elzeviers woodcut device on the title page, and several woodcut decorated initials and headpieces. 19th-century gold-tooled red morocco, bound by Georges Trautz ("Trautz-Bauzonnet"). The book is kept in a protective red paper slipcase, the whole kept in a custom-made beige cloth box, lined with red cloth. [12], 252 pp. Full description
